Output 6331a042ebfb0fab680ca061298c7eb8c6c826e35528cd00d8b99637cf942d8a:2

value
14372091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f510b70d0dbde701ea27058bb2ebb4af1080d5 OP_EQUAL
address
32sXcHErWiNf2PGqS9Uzkv4eg2wMLuNUtw
transaction
6331a042ebfb0fab680ca061298c7eb8c6c826e35528cd00d8b99637cf942d8a
spent
true